Understanding Waste Incineration

Incineration is a waste treatment process that involves the combustion of organic substances contained in waste materials. This method reduces the waste volume and can convert waste into energy, providing a dual benefit of waste management and energy generation. However, the process also raises concerns about emissions and their impact on air quality.

Environmental Concerns

Despite its benefits, the incineration process is accompanied by notable environmental concerns. Critics argue that:

  • Emissions: Even with advanced technologies, incinerators can release harmful pollutants into the atmosphere, potentially affecting local air quality.
  • Toxic Residue: The ash produced from incineration can contain heavy metals and other hazardous substances, posing challenges for disposal and management.
  • Public Health Risks: Studies have suggested a potential link between incinerator emissions and health issues in communities located nearby.
